Trunkster: The Birth of a Baggage Revolution

Trunkster, founded by Jesse Potash and Aaron Birch, was born out of a desire to revolutionize the way we travel. These two tech-savvy entrepreneurs saw the need for luggage that could keep up with the modern traveler's demands. They envisioned a world where your suitcase could charge your phone, help you find it if it got lost, and even tell you if you'd packed too much. And so, in 2015, Trunkster net worth began to grow as the company launched its first product, the Trunkster Suitcase.

The Trunkster Suitcase: A Tech-Packed Travel Companion

The Trunkster Suitcase is no ordinary luggage. It's packed with features that make it a traveler's dream. Here are a few of its standout features:

- GPS Tracking: Never lose your luggage again. The Trunkster Suitcase comes with a built-in GPS tracker that lets you keep an eye on your bag's location via the Trunkster app.

- Weight Sensor: The Trunkster app also includes a weight sensor that tells you if you're packing too much. No more airport weigh-ins or excess baggage fees!

- USB Charger: Because nobody wants to be caught with a dead phone at the airport, the Trunkster Suitcase comes with a built-in USB charger.

- Zipperless Design: The Trunkster Suitcase uses a unique 'butterfly' opening system instead of zippers, making it easier to pack and unpack.

Trunkster's Rise to Fame

Trunkster's innovative design and tech-savvy features caught the attention of travelers and tech enthusiasts alike. The company's first product, the Trunkster Suitcase, was a massive hit, raising over $1.4 million on Kickstarter alone. This early success contributed significantly to the Trunkster net worth growth.

The company's popularity also led to it being featured in numerous tech and travel publications, including Wired, Forbes, and The Verge. Trunkster's innovative approach to luggage also earned it several awards, such as the CES Innovation Award and the Red Dot Design Award.

Trunkster Net Worth: How Much is the Company Worth?

Now, let's get to the main event: Trunkster net worth. As a private company, Trunkster doesn't publicly disclose its financials. However, we can make some educated guesses based on available information.

- Funding: Trunkster has raised around $4 million in funding from various investors, including Lerer Hippeau, Rhapsody Venture Partners, and HAX. - Sales: Trunkster's luggage has been a hit with customers. The company's Kickstarter campaign alone generated over $1.4 million in sales. Since then, Trunkster has continued to generate revenue through its website and retail partnerships. - Valuation: While we don't have an exact figure for Trunkster net worth, industry experts estimate that the company is worth several million dollars.
